We are currently recruiting for an experienced Litigated Personal Injury Fee Earner / Solicitor (Fast Track non-hire) to join our team based in Bolton. This is an excellent opportunity for someone who is passionate about delivering high-quality legal services and achieving the best possible outcomes for their clients.

Due to continued growth and development, we are looking to appoint a Fee Earner or Solicitor with 1 2 years litigated personal injury experience to join our established PI team. If you are driven, ambitious and looking for a rewarding and stimulating career, we would love to hear from you.

Responsibilities

Manage and progress your own litigated caseload from defence stage through to settlement or trial

Provide clear, professional and timely legal advice while managing client expectations

Work to deadlines and ensure cases progress efficiently

Deliver exceptional client care at every stage of the process

About You

Experienced in managing a personal injury caseload, ideally with litigated Fast Track files

Highly organised with strong case management skills

Excellent communication and telephone manner

Strong negotiation and problem-solving abilities

Committed to delivering outstanding client service

Able to work effectively both independently and as part of a team, using your own initiative
